Output 8e5ead074bd1d40b4a6d4fd9d3e3ef8db6ef42ca4baf987d0fc4f8f64903bced:3

value
665553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9dcc0755fec588046dabe6da784d0bdb00a462d OP_EQUAL
address
3HBAa4oiakm79J7pNfzATc41xqQEQBSX2Q
transaction
8e5ead074bd1d40b4a6d4fd9d3e3ef8db6ef42ca4baf987d0fc4f8f64903bced
confirmations
265421
spent
true